Nine lines drawn parallel to the base of a triangle divide the other two sides into 10 equal parts and the area into 10 distinct parts. If the area of the largest of these parts is 1997 sq.cms, find the area of the triangle. If ans is in the form of a b \frac ab , where a a and b b are coprime positive integers, submit a + b a+b as your answer.


The answer is 199719.

The part of the triangle not included in the bottom trapezium is a triangle with a base 9 10 × b \frac{9}{10}\times b and height 9 10 × h \frac{9}{10}\times h (where b b and h h are the base and height of the original triangle) giving it area

9 10 × 9 10 A = 81 100 A \frac{9}{10}\times\frac{9}{10}A=\frac{81}{100}A .

What's left is the trapezium with area equal to 100 81 100 A = 19 100 A \frac{100-81}{100}A=\frac{19}{100}A therefore

1997 = 19 100 A 1997=\frac{19}{100}A and

A = 1997 × 100 19 A=\frac{1997\times 100}{19}
